数控车床牙距怎么编程出来

时间:2025-01-28 09:39:20 网络游戏

在数控车床上编程实现牙距的加工,主要依赖于螺纹插补编程。以下是实现牙距编程的步骤和要点:

螺距计算

确定所需的螺距,螺距是螺纹的每圈进给量,通常用毫米或英寸表示。

根据螺距的不同,选择合适的螺纹加工方式,例如单程螺纹或多程螺纹。

螺纹类型选择

根据实际需求,选择合适的螺纹类型,如直螺纹、斜螺纹、圆锥螺纹等。

起始位置确定

确定螺纹的起始位置,通常是螺纹的第一个点。起始位置的选择对于螺纹加工的精度和质量有一定影响。

编程方式

大螺距的螺纹加工可以使用G92编程方式。G92是一种常用的数控编程指令,用于定义坐标系原点或坐标系偏移。

对于大螺距螺纹,可以先用G76进行粗车,然后用G92进行精车,以提高加工精度和效率。

具体编程步骤

使用G76指令进行粗车:

```

G76 P0100 Q150 R0.03;

G76 X Z P Q R F;

```

其中,P0100表示梯形螺纹牙型角,Q150表示每次吃刀量(单位微米),R0.03表示精车余量(半径值),X和Z是目标点坐标,P是牙型高,Q是第一刀的吃刀量,R是锥螺纹编程的螺纹起点与终点的半径差。

使用G92指令进行精车:

```

G92 X Z F;

```

其中,X和Z是目标点坐标,F是螺距。

其他注意事项

在编程过程中,需要使用到一系列的G代码和M代码来控制数控车床的工作,例如G01表示直线插补,G02和G03表示圆弧插补,G92用于设定坐标系原点等。

编程时要保证数控系统和机床的准确性和稳定性,以确保加工出的螺距精度符合要求。

根据实际情况进行调试和优化,以提高加工效率和质量。

通过以上步骤和要点,可以实现数控车床上牙距的精确编程和加工。